Whipped Shea Butter
Whipped Shea Butter is great for general moisturising all over the body, and we use it daily on our son as part of his "post bath" routine. The Shea Butter melts on contact with the skin and once massaged in there is no greasy residue.
Shea & Cocoa Lotion Bars
If your child has itchy areas of skin, we would recommend the Shea & Cocoa Butter Lotion Bar. It’s fantastic as a massage medium. The Shea butter sinks right in and the cocoa butter forms a sort of barrier, which can prevent itchiness - again, once this has sunk in (doesn't take long), there is no greasiness behind. It's easy to apply as its bar format means that it is only applied where you want it to, and you don't get it over your hands.
Just Shea
On really bad areas or on nappy rash, cradle cap and so on, we recommend Just Shea. This has the highest concentration of Shea Butter (98%) and is therefore the most nourishing and moisturising of our products.
Shea & Cocoa Butter Bath Melts
If you frequently used off the shelf products to use in your child's bath to help their dry skin, you can simply pop one of the bath melts in the bath. This may eliminate the need to moisturise afterwards. As their bath water won't be as hot as an adults, you may find that you or your child can rub the bath melt over themselves, and they enjoy watching it melt. You will have to wash the bath out afterwards, as it will be slippery. To avoid having to moisturise, just pat dry with a towel.
Shea Botty Balm
At the first sign of nappy rash, apply a small amount to the affected areas. You do not need to use the Botty Balm at every nappy change. You may also find it useful for older children if they have chaffing, eczema patches and so on as the oils used are all anti-inflammatory and calming. If you suffer from eczema, you can also use it, and some customers have used it on spots too!
Shea Butter Soaps
You can use any of our Shea Butter soaps on your children - we do. Our son physically tries to stop me if someone orders Chunky Monkey Business! He loves it that much. The soaps are so kind to your skin, and are suitable for all of the family. If your child has eczema, you can also use them. You may want to use the Plain, unscented soap, or the Chickweed & Evening Primrose soap, but we've used all of the soaps on our son without a reaction. If in any doubt, choose the unscented. What about you? What can you use?
As a mother, you can use anything. If you are pregnant or breast feeding, then check which essential oils are safe for you to use.
If you're pregnant, the only scent that we recommend not using is Grapefruit Lemon & Mint, as it contains Peppermint Essential Oil, and this is advised against during pregnancy. Just Shea for Feet also contains this essential oil.
